    Disa alticola

    Disa alticola is a slender terrestrial orchid, growing from a tuberous rootstock.

    The plant occurs in Mpumalanga and may be more widely distributed in moist grassland at higher altitudes of the old Transvaal. The plant is known in the Steenkampsberge. The species is considered vulnerable in its habitat early in the twenty first century (iSpot; Wikipedia; www.orchids.wikia.com; www.redlist.sanbi.org).
